Community views: improve searching

Featured Replies

Hello,

 

as nice as the Community idea is, it is currently inconvenient to use it.

 

If I want to find views for my current aircraft, I want to see all the possibilities. But when I search for a pilot view, I have to enter a search string and hope to match other users namings. So a overhead view could be "Overhead", OVHD, OHD, Upper view, etc.

To search through all that possibilities takes longer then to make an own view (what shows how easy it is to make new views with CP ;) )

 

And I do not understand why I also have to insert the airplane, as sitting in a 747 I wouldn't search fo anything else then a 747 ... or why do I have to type in 747?

 

I do not know how to make it better, maybe a kind of naming convention? So, if you make new views, you could choose from a pre-given naming set. PILOT, OVHD, PEDESTAL FWD, OVHD FWD, OVHD BACK, etc.

Similar for outside views: CHASE, REAR LEFT, REAR RIGHT, GEAR, etc.

 

But currentl yit doesn't make much sense in my opinion ...

Hi,

Thank you for your feedback.

As you can see in the Community tab, the Browse function is disable. It is in development and will come with the features you would expect. We want to build it right and we wanted to see how people would use the community before designing this part.

Currently, you can search for keywords and get results for any aircraft. just let the aircraft field blank.

4 hours ago, Endriu88 said:

Hi guys,

It would also be nice to be able to search for a specific user name. For example if one would like to have the same presets seen on a YouTube video or on a friend's simulator. Maybe the browse function will include this.

You can search a specific username by typing user:fsfxpackages
